They lost both the Harold Matthews and the SG Ball this year.

Penrith's first ever semi final was a 38-6 loss to Parramatta in 1985.

2000 Parramatta beat them in a semi final 28-10 to eliminate them. After Parramatta were trailing 10-0 at one stage.
